Metro District Water Operator School
Conducted by the:
- Minnesota Department of Health, and
- American Water Works Association - Minnesota Section
Tuesday, May 6 to Thursday, May 8, 2025
Eagan Community Center
1501 Central Parkway
Eagan, Minnesota 55121
651-675-5550
Attendees will receive 16 contact hours.
A certification exam will be held at 8:30 a.m. on May 8. Because of space constraints, there is an 80-person limit for the exam. The limit for people taking the C or D exam prep on May 7 is 60.
Applications for the certification exam must be received by the Minnesota Department of Health at least 15 days before the exam. Download the exam application below:
or contact Noel Hansen: noel.hansen@state.mn.us, 651-201-4690.
